A native of Buffalo, he was the son of the late James M. and Vera Gregory Kingsmore.
He retired after 45 years with United Merchants, Buffalo Plant. He was a member of Putman Baptist Church, where he was a former deacon and custodian.
Survivors include his wife, Bertie O'Shields Kingsmore; one daughter, Karen K. Sullivan of Huntington, W.Va.; four sons, John F. Kingsmore of Glendale, Ariz., Kenneth H. Kingsmore of Poquoson , Va., Terry A. Kingsmore of Simpsonville and Karmen D. Kingsmore of Buffalo; three sisters, Lillie K. Parks of Union, Katharine K. Spence of Augusta, Ga., and Audrey K. Harmon of Georgetown; one brother, Willis Kingsmore of Union; and eight grandchildren.
The family will receive friends from 7 to 9 tonight at the S.R Holcombe Funeral Home. Services will be held at 3 p.m. Friday at Putman Baptist Church, conducted by the Rev. Donald Tillman. Burial will be in the church cemetery. The body will be placed in the church at 2 p.m.
The family is at the home.
Memorials may be made to Putman Baptist Church Building Fund, 3692 Buffalo-West Springs Highway, Buffalo, 29321 or Hospice Program of Spartanburg Regional Medical Center, 120 Heywood Ave., Suite 300, Spartanburg, 29302.
